Understanding the Mechanics of Efficiency

Our puzzle parking systems function through a sophisticated lattice of pallets that move both vertically and horizontally. The "Pit Type" configuration specifically allows for the ground level to act as a driveway, while the vehicles beneath are lowered into a concrete pit. This design not only enhances aesthetic value—keeping the visual clutter of cars hidden—but also adheres to rigorous safety standards required by CE Certification. FAQ: Navigating Technical Specifications and Purchasing

Q: What is the primary safety benefit of CE Certified systems?
A: CE Certification confirms that the system meets European health, safety, and environmental protection standards. For our pit-type systems, this includes redundant anti-fall locks, emergency stop systems, and photo-electric detection to prevent accidents.
